24-HOUR PUBLIC WEATHER FORECAST Issued at: 5:00 AM 25 October 2014 SYNOPSIS: Intertropical Convergence Zone(ITCZ) affecting Mindanao. Northeast Monsoon affecting extreme Northern Luzon. Forecast: Davao Region, CARAGA and SOCCSKSARGEN will experience cloudy skies with light to moderate rainshowers and thunderstorms. Cagayan Valley will have partly cloudy to at times cloudy skies with isolated light rains. Metro Manila and the rest of the country will be partly cloudy to cloudy with isolated rainshowers or thunderstorms. Moderate to occasionally strong winds blowing from the northeast will prevail over Luzon and Eastern Visayas and the coastal waters along these areas will be moderate to occasionally rough. Elsewhere, winds will be light to moderate coming from the northeast to north with slight to moderate seas.
